yeah i wish it was that easy, since i got the bike its been running terribly, it doesnt idle well (was rev hunting to start with now its spluttering on idle) and it splutters on low throttle. also the valve cover on the bottom of the motor had a loose nut so i tried to tighten it to find the thread in the head was totally stripped so it doesnt seal properly and when hot leaks oil. warranty issue im in the middle of dealing with warranty with atomik.
 
Keep us updated, this will be interesting i think..... Also check the inlet manifold bolts, my Nitrous had loose bolts on the engine side of the inlet manifold straight out of the box, which made for low power, bad idle and spluttering, just something else to check. Good luck with the warranty thing.
 
nah mate im in adelaide, yeah when it was rev hunting a mate and i checked to make sure all intake parts were sealed properly. everything was done up tight intake wise so it wasnt a vacuum leak issue with the manifold>head or carby>manifold. do these motors run a pcv valve? or straight to atmosphere cos if it has a pcv valve the loose valve cover could be creating a vacuum leak so ive been told by a mechanic and from what ive read online about other motors
